This commit is contained in:
2026-06-01 20:07:58 +02:00
parent 6021cdef28
commit 6dfb24de7e

View File

@@ -24,7 +24,7 @@ from src.config.settings import settings
from src.core.entities.series import Serie
from src.core.exceptions.Exceptions import MatchNotFoundError, NoKeyFoundException
from src.core.providers.base_provider import Loader
from src.core.utils.key_utils import generate_key_from_folder, is_valid_key
from src.core.utils.key_utils import generate_key_from_folder
from src.server.database.connection import get_sync_session
from src.server.database.service import AnimeSeriesService, EpisodeService
@@ -726,16 +726,6 @@ class SerieScanner:
try:
generated_key = generate_key_from_folder(folder_name)
year_from_folder = self._extract_year_from_folder_name(folder_name)
# Validate that the generated key is usable
if not generated_key or not is_valid_key(generated_key):
logger.warning(
"Serie key is invalid for folder '%s' (key='%s') - skipping",
folder_name,
generated_key
)
return None
logger.info(
"Generated key for folder '%s' -> key='%s'",
folder_name,
@@ -751,7 +741,7 @@ class SerieScanner:
)
except Exception as exc:
logger.warning(
"Unexpected error generating key for folder '%s': %s",
"Failed to generate key for folder '%s': %s",
folder_name,
exc
)